Kate Henshaw, Basorge return in ‘Candlelight’ Spin off ‘Do-Good’

Kate Henshaw, Basorge return in ‘Candlelight’ Spin off ‘Do-Good’
June 19
13:51 2015

Comic great and renowned Nollywood actor, Basorge Tariah Jnr, and Nollywood leading lady, Kate Henshaw, are returning to the small screen as Africa Magic premieres its new Pidgin English sitcom, DoGood, on Monday, July 6, 2015.

DoGood, is a spin-off of the popular Nigerian drama series of the 1990s, Candlelight, which older TV viewers would remember nostalgically.

The 90’s soap always had an interesting dynamic between the maid (played by Kate Henshaw) and DoGood (played by Basorge). In this new show, DoGood returns from a sojourn abroad to woo his sweetheart Emem, played by Kate Henshaw.

DoGood also tells a story of love and ambition and focuses on the struggles of the ordinary man. It is a humorous depiction of real life situations.

Kate Henshaw, one of Nigeria’s most iconic actors, shared her excitement with TheCable and also talked about her history with Basorge.

“It is a lovely feeling to be able to reprise the role of Emem. I especially love the character immensely,” she said.

“Basorge and I have remained friends over the past 15 years plus, but not had a chance to be in front of the camera apart from anchoring events together sometimes. It is great to get back in the saddle working with him. He is a true professional.”

“Every aspect of the series is going to be exciting. Apart from Basorge and I, there are new characters in the series portrayed by very talented and young new actors. It is definitely going to keep audiences glued to their seats”.

A Multichoice representative, Efosa Aiyevbomwan, told TheCable: “The show is an opportunity for a rebirth of those characters for the older audiences and also re-introducing the younger audience to classic characters and content.

“So the idea for DoGood came about as a means of increasing the options for Africa Magic’s viewers. Do-good is a first of its kind Pidgin English sitcom, and promises to be a hit with audiences.

“Kate and Basorge were more than thrilled to reprise their memorable roles as Emem and Do-good respectively.

“The characters have evolved significantly from where most viewers remember them. Do-good returns from his travels to woo his sweetheart Emem. What happens afterwards is a series of comedic events.

“The evolution of the characters and where they are now, in conjunction with the funny instances and situations that characterize their relationship, definitely makes for good viewing. The new show holds many exciting and surprising moments for viewers.”
